About Opera y Palacio Real
The small neighbourhood of Opera y Palacio Real sits next to the Royal Palace and its grand squares with manicured gardens. It’s also home to El Teatro Royal, the grand opera house. This part of town has an abundance of space and is far less busy than other parts of central Madrid – the calmness of the area makes it popular with families. You’ll find high-end local shops to peruse, as well as excellent restaurants, in this refined and sedate neighbourhood.

Mix art and cocktails at Hopper
Hopper is a unique bar in La Latina, where you can see exhibitions while enjoying a cocktail–both their cocktail menu and cultural offer change often, so one visit is not enough.
Dine and drink with great views at El Viajero
One of Madrid's most popular summer hangouts with a shabby chic vibe, El Viajero offer fantastic tapas and great space for a beer in the sun.
Experience the history of the Church of San Andres
This is one of the oldest churches in the city, located on a beautiful corner of Madrid.
Dine at the iconic Casa Lucio
This nineteenth-century Spanish tavern-style restaurant has a lively atmosphere, which makes it popular with tourists. Make sure you book a table and try the famous Huevos Rotos!
Grab an early table at Juana La Loca
A charming tapas bar in La Latina, well known in the area for their famous and unmistakable pincho of tortilla de patata with onion confit. Come early to avoid the queue.
Enjoy the wonderful food and service at Ástor
If you're keen on first-class service and like seeing chefs at work, then Ástor is the place to be. This family-run favourite is always booked–make sure to get your table in advance.
Shop and eat organic at Kiki Market
An organic produce heaven, Kiki market also has a tearoom in the basement where they put their delicious ingredients to the taste test.
Sample authentic tapas at Los Huevos de Lucio
Small but always packed, Los Huevos de Lucio is a great choice for traditional Spanish tapas–a true gem of Madrid's gastronomic scene.
Come see the San Pedro el Viejo church
Come and enjoy discovering this Medieval church's combination of architectural styles.
Experience the amazing vibe at La Musa Latina
La Musa Latina's lounge bar on the ground floor is a good place to sip a cocktail and chat with friends in a chilled out atmosphere.
Shop for fresh ingredients at Mercado de la Cebada
This iconic market that's been open for over a hundred years specialises in fresh food only. Come for the best seafood, fruit, and vegetables.
Discover authentic Italian cuisine at Emma & Julia
This traditional Italian eatery has been attracting lovers of pasta for over twenty years – and they offer gluten-free options too!
Discover the hidden Garden of the Prince of Anglona
This Garden is a small, partially hidden jewel located in the heart of Madrid. It was commissioned by the Marquises of La Romana and admired ever since.
Try the best T-bone in town at Casa Julián de Tolosa
This traditional steakhouse prides itself with the best chuletón in town–a succulent, perfectly done T-bone steak.
Soak in the sights at Plaza de la Paja
This postcard-worthy square is an ideal place to have a drink or a bite to eat while admiring architecture that spans several centuries.
